Best 48475 Michigan Public Elementary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public elementary schools serving 617 students in 48475, MI.
The top-ranked public elementary schools in 48475, MI are Ubly Community Jrsr High School and Ubly Community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public elementary schools in zipcode 48475 have an average math proficiency score of 52% (versus the Michigan public elementary school average of 35%), and reading proficiency score of 58% (versus the 44% statewide average). Elementary schools in 48475, MI have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Michigan public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 3%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Michigan public elementary school average of 38% (majority Black).
